Position Summary

 

The Departmentof Ophthalmology and Vision Sciences at the University of New Mexico invitesapplications for a Post Doctoral fellow position. We are seeking aresearch-focused and experienced individual with strong analytical,organizational, and interpersonal skills. The successful candidate will conductresearch in Dr. Islam’s lab in the department.  Dr. Islam’s research is focus oncornea regeneration including cell therapy.

The successfulcandidate will conduct research involving animal models, specifically using therabbit cornea. Responsibilities also include publishing findings in leadingjournals and conferences, leading group projects, and collaborating with bothgraduate and undergraduate students on research initiatives.

The candidateshould be available to start immediately.

The idealcandidate should have:
A record ofpeer-reviewed publications and prior research experience in ophthalmology,including experience in handling rabbits for ocular research (preferably, butnot limited to, studies involving the rabbit cornea) and conducting laboratoryexperiments.
Demonstratedexperience in cell biology techniques.
